Typical hot water heater emergencies as well as just how to take care of them


Insufficient warm water


Managing an insufficient supply of warm water can be frustrating. It may be that the water heater can not sustain the hot water demand for your apartment or condo. To handle this issue, you can attempt to adjust your heating unit's temperature level dial and await a couple of minutes. You can ask for the aid of a professional plumber if the trouble lingers. Additionally, you can upgrade your water heater to one with a bigger capability.

Rising and fall water temperature.


Your water heater might start producing water of different temperature levels normally ice cool or scalding hot. In this situation, the first thing you do is to make certain that the temperature level is readied to the wanted degree. If after doing this, the water temperature maintains transforming during showers or other activities, you may have a damaged thermostat. There might be a requirement to change either the home heating or the thermostat system of your water heater.

Leaky water heater container.


A dripping container could be an indicator of deterioration. It could cause damage to the flooring, wall surface and electrical devices around it. You might even go to danger of having your house flooded. In this circumstance, you should turn off your water heater, allow it to cool, and meticulously search for the resource of the problem. Sometimes, all you require to do is to tighten a couple of screws or pipeline connections in cases of small leaks. Yet if this doesn't work and the leakage continues, you may need to use the services of a professional for a proper substitute.

Blemished or stinky water


You require to recognize if the issue is from the tank or the water source when this happens. You are particular that it is your water heater that is defective if there is no funny odor when you run cool water. The smelly water can be brought on by corrosion or the accumulation of microorganisms or sediments in the hot water heater storage tank. You can attempt flushing out your tank or changing the anode if the trouble lingers when you observe this. The function of the anode is to clear out germs from your tank. Because the anode pole replacement calls for a comprehensive understanding of your water heating unit, you will require the aid of an expert.

9 COMMON CAUSES OF WATER HEATER LEAKS


Why Is My Hot Water Heater Leaking?


Old Water Tank


Just like with any other household appliance, water tanks wear down as they age. Older water tanks are more susceptible to leaks and lower water retention. Generally, a leaking water tank results from rust buildup that causes internal corrosion. As the inside of the tank corrodes, cracks form that allow water to escape. You can patch the cracks to buy some time, but this is only a temporary fix. Eventually, you’ll need a new unit.


Drain Valve


You can use the drain valve on your water heater to empty and clean the tank. This component can become loose as it encounters continuous usage throughout the years. If your hot water heater is leaking, the source of the issue may be a loose drain valve. You may notice a mild water leak due to small openings that weren’t there before. Sometimes a simple tightening will do the trick, but if the valve is loose at the base, you will need to replace it.


High Pressure


Your water heater will naturally create pressure as it increases the water’s temperature. But too much pressure can cause problems. If excess pressure can’t escape the unit properly, water starts to leak through any cracks that are present.


Malfunctioning Temperature & Pressure Relief Valve


The problem above may result from a malfunctioning pressure relief valve. When the internal pressure of your water tank gets too high, the pressure relief valve allows steam to escape the unit and return to a stable temperature. Sometimes the valve just gets loose and needs to be tightened, but if it’s broken, you need to replace it with a new one.


Inlet & Outlet Connections


During the heating process, cold water comes into the tank through the inlet connection, and hot water exits through the outlet connection to travel through the pipes in your home. As with drain and pressure relief valves, these connections can loosen over time and cause a water heater leak. If this happens, either try to tighten the connections yourself or call a professional plumber.


Tank Interior


Water heaters have two “shells,” an internal shell that contains the water and an external shell that insulates the internal shell. While water leaks coming from the external shell are easy to spot because it’s just covered by a thin metal layer, they’re harder to catch in the internal shell because it’s covered by two layers of material.


Collection of Sediment


Here’s why regular water heater maintenance is so important. If you neglect cleaning the tank, sediment builds up at the bottom and eventually causes the unit to crack. The formation of cracks in the tank can cause a mild to severe water heater leak in your home. If the tank starts leaking, all you can do is replace it entirely.
